
Black-fronted Forktail
Ischnura denticollis
Native
Status: Uncommon

Size: very small and delicate
Length - 21 - 26 mm
Eye color - small circular eyespots
Face color - male: female:
Thorax color - male: dark, blue sides, female: immature - pale coral, mature female greenish blue
Abdomen color - male: blue patches on top and lime below
Stigma color - white margin at back
Appendages - top bent down
Habitat - lakes, ponds, seeps
Behavior - lays eggs in tandem
Flight period - March-November in our area
Range - eastern Oregon east to Kansas and south to Texas, Baja California, and Guatemala, all of California except northern coast
